Is an employee who terminates before working a full year entitled to vacation pay?
An employee must be employed 14 calendar days before they are entitled to vacation pay. If the employee has been employed 14 calendar days they are entitled to 4% of their gross wages as vacation pay. Vacation pay must be paid to them within seven (7) calendar days of the termination of employment.
